Mr. Baseball is a delightful sports comedy film released in 1992. Directed by Fred Schepisi, this movie tells the story of an American baseball player named Jack Elliot, played by the legendary Tom Selleck, and his journey through the cultural challenges of playing professional baseball in Japan.

The film follows Jack Elliot, a veteran first baseman who gets traded to the Chunichi Dragons in Japan after his Major League Baseball career starts to decline. Jack's brash and arrogant personality clashes with the traditional Japanese values and customs of his new team. As he struggles to adapt to the Japanese way of life, he encounters various obstacles, cultural misunderstandings, and language barriers.

Despite his initial resistance, Jack starts to develop a profound respect for his teammates and the Japanese culture. He learns valuable life lessons about teamwork, humility, and the importance of honor and discipline. As the story progresses, Jack's personal growth and determination lead him to regain his love for the game and become an integral part of the Chunichi Dragons.
